  1. LV 10500 IZGUDROJUMA FORMULA KOMPLEKSĀ ΑΝΤΙΒΙΟΤΙΚΑ - CIKLOSPORĪNA UN/VAI TĀ KOMPONENTU UN SĒNĪŠU KULTŪRAS. TOLTPOCLADIUM YARIUM IEGŪŠANAS PAŅĒMIENS 1. Kompleksā antibiotiķa - ciklosporīna un/vai tā komponentu iegūšanas paņēmiens, kurā ietilpst producenta kultivēšana aerobos apstākļos barotnē, kura satur asimilējamus oglekļa, slāpekļa un minerālsāļu avotus, ar tai sekojošu galaņroduktu izdalīšanu, kas atšķiras ar to, ka kā producentu izmanto sēnīti Tol^pocladium varium N CAIM/P/F 001005, un kultivēšanu realizē 25-3O°0 temperatūrā*
  2. 2· Paņēmiens, saskaņā ar 1. punktu, kas atšķiras ar to, ka kā slāpekļa avotu izmanto peptonu, amonija sulfātu, tripkazīnu, kā oglekļa avotu - glikozi, maltozi, sor-bītu*
  3. 3. Sēnīšu kultūra Tolypocladium varium N CAIM/P/F 001005 - kompleksā antibiotiķa - ciklosporīna un/vai tā komponentu producents.
